A student adds 20 grams of green food coloring to two beakers of water, one at 4°C and the other at 70°C respectively. He discovered that the food coloring spreads faster in hot water than in cold water. Why do you think this occurred

An increase in temperature increases the average kinetic energy of the coloring molecules.

Kinetic theory of molecules

The faster spreading of the food coloring at a higher temperature follows the kinetic theory of molecules.

According to the theory, the average kinetic energy of molecules depends on their temperatures. Thus, the more their temperatures, the faster they move.

This means that the molecules of the food coloring spread faster at 70°C because they move faster as a result of the higher temperature - unlike those at 4°C
